Understanding the Issue

Why Water Damage Matters During Escrow

Water damage discovered during a home inspection is one of the most common sources of transaction uncertainty in California real estate. Inspectors identify visible evidence of moisture — staining, deterioration, elevated moisture readings — but they are not licensed to define the construction scope or cost of repairs. That gap between "there is water damage" and "here is what it costs to fix it" is where transactions stall.

Hidden leaks create particular uncertainty because the visible damage rarely reflects the full extent of the problem. A stained ceiling may indicate a minor roof penetration — or it may indicate years of moisture accumulation in the attic framing above. A soft spot in a bathroom floor may indicate a surface issue — or a failed shower pan that has been saturating the subfloor for a decade. Without a professional construction evaluation, no one can know.

Water damage affects transaction negotiations in direct and indirect ways. Buyers use water damage findings to negotiate price reductions or repair credits — sometimes appropriately, sometimes based on incomplete information. Sellers face the choice of completing repairs, offering credits, or watching transactions fall apart. Agents on both sides need accurate information to advise their clients.

Determining the extent of damage — and the cost of proper reconstruction — is the essential first step. A professional evaluation by a licensed general contractor provides the written scope and cost estimate that gives all parties a factual basis for decisions. Proper reconstruction, documented with permits and contractor records, resolves the uncertainty and allows transactions to proceed.

Why moisture damage appears during inspections

Home inspectors use moisture meters and visual inspection to identify conditions that warrant further evaluation. Many water damage conditions are invisible to the naked eye and only become apparent through systematic moisture investigation — which is why water damage is frequently discovered during the inspection period rather than before listing.

Why hidden leaks create uncertainty

Hidden leaks — in shower assemblies, under kitchen cabinets, around windows — can go undetected for years. The visible damage at the time of inspection may represent only a fraction of the actual moisture damage present. This uncertainty is resolved through professional evaluation, not speculation.

How water damage affects negotiations

Water damage findings without a professional evaluation create maximum uncertainty — and maximum negotiating friction. A written scope of work and cost estimate from a licensed contractor converts uncertainty into a defined, negotiable item. Transactions with documented repair proposals close more reliably than those with unresolved water damage findings.

Why proper reconstruction matters

Surface repairs that do not address underlying moisture damage leave the problem in place. Buyers who accept cosmetic repairs without proper reconstruction inherit the original problem — and the liability that comes with it. Proper reconstruction addresses the root cause, restores the building system, and provides documentation that protects the new owner.

Common Water Damage We Evaluate

The following types of water damage are commonly discovered during California real estate transactions. Each entry explains the common causes, potential consequences, and when reconstruction may be necessary — providing the educational context that buyers, sellers, and agents need to understand what they are dealing with.

Leaking Showers

Common causes: Shower leaks originate from failed grout, cracked tile, deteriorated caulk joints, or — most commonly — failed waterproofing membranes beneath the tile surface that are invisible to the naked eye.

Potential consequences: Water migrates through the shower assembly into the subfloor, wall framing, and adjacent rooms. Over time this causes wood rot, mold growth, and structural deterioration that extends well beyond the shower itself.

When reconstruction may be necessary: When the waterproofing system has failed, surface repairs are insufficient. Reconstruction requires removing tile and substrate, replacing damaged structural materials, and installing a proper waterproofing system before restoring finishes.

Failed Shower Pans

Common causes: Shower pan failures occur when the liner cracks, separates at seams, or was improperly installed — allowing water to bypass the pan and saturate the subfloor assembly below.

Potential consequences: A failed shower pan can saturate subfloor materials for years before visible damage appears. By the time a home inspection identifies the problem, structural damage is often significant.

When reconstruction may be necessary: Shower pan replacement requires full demolition of the shower floor, assessment of subfloor and framing condition, replacement of damaged structural materials, and installation of a properly sloped and waterproofed pan system.

Improper Waterproofing

Common causes: Many bathrooms in California homes were built or remodeled without proper waterproofing — using materials that are not appropriate for wet areas or installation methods that do not meet current building standards.

Potential consequences: Improper waterproofing allows moisture to migrate into wall assemblies and floor systems continuously. The damage accumulates slowly and is rarely visible until it becomes significant.

When reconstruction may be necessary: Correcting improper waterproofing requires removing existing finishes, assessing the extent of moisture damage, replacing affected materials, and installing a waterproofing system appropriate for the application.

Bathroom Water Damage

Common causes: Bathroom water damage results from a combination of sources — shower leaks, toilet seal failures, supply line failures, and chronic condensation — that accumulate over the life of the home.

Potential consequences: Bathroom water damage affects subfloors, wall framing, adjacent rooms, and in multi-story homes, the ceiling of the room below. The full extent is rarely visible without investigation.

When reconstruction may be necessary: Bathroom reconstruction scope depends on the extent of damage. Minor cases may require only subfloor repair and waterproofing correction. Significant cases require full bathroom reconstruction including framing, subfloor, and all finishes.

Kitchen Water Damage

Common causes: Kitchen water damage originates from dishwasher leaks, sink drain failures, supply line failures under the sink, and refrigerator ice maker line failures — often going undetected for extended periods.

Potential consequences: Water under kitchen cabinets saturates cabinet bases, subfloor materials, and wall framing. In severe cases, damage extends to the crawl space or basement below.

When reconstruction may be necessary: Kitchen water damage reconstruction requires removing affected cabinets, assessing and replacing damaged subfloor and framing, addressing the moisture source, and restoring the kitchen to functional condition.

Cabinet Damage

Common causes: Cabinet damage from water exposure results in swelling, delamination, mold growth on interior surfaces, and structural failure of cabinet boxes — particularly in base cabinets near plumbing.

Potential consequences: Water-damaged cabinets cannot be effectively dried and restored. Mold growth inside cabinet interiors creates ongoing air quality concerns and must be addressed before the property transfers.

When reconstruction may be necessary: Damaged cabinets require removal and replacement. The scope of reconstruction depends on whether the damage is limited to cabinet surfaces or has extended to the wall and floor structure behind and beneath them.

Subfloor Damage

Common causes: Subfloor damage results from chronic moisture exposure from bathroom leaks, kitchen plumbing failures, and crawl space moisture — causing wood fiber breakdown, delamination of engineered panels, and structural weakening.

Potential consequences: Damaged subfloor creates soft spots, squeaking, and in advanced cases, structural failure. It also provides a substrate for mold growth that affects indoor air quality.

When reconstruction may be necessary: Subfloor reconstruction requires removing finished flooring, assessing the extent of damage, replacing affected panels or boards, and addressing the moisture source before installing new flooring.

Drywall Damage

Common causes: Drywall damage from water exposure results in paper face deterioration, gypsum core breakdown, and mold growth on paper surfaces — particularly in bathrooms and areas adjacent to plumbing.

Potential consequences: Water-damaged drywall cannot be effectively dried and restored. Mold growth on drywall paper is a common finding in homes with chronic moisture problems and must be addressed before property transfer.

When reconstruction may be necessary: Damaged drywall requires removal and replacement. The scope depends on whether damage is limited to surface materials or has extended to the framing behind the drywall.

Wood Rot

Common causes: Wood rot in residential construction results from chronic moisture exposure — typically from bathroom leaks, window failures, roof penetrations, or crawl space moisture — that sustains fungal growth in wood framing.

Potential consequences: Rotted framing members lose structural capacity and must be replaced. In load-bearing locations, wood rot creates safety concerns that affect the habitability and insurability of the property.

When reconstruction may be necessary: Wood rot reconstruction requires removing affected framing, assessing the structural implications, replacing damaged members with properly treated materials, and addressing the moisture source that caused the deterioration.

Hidden Moisture

Common causes: Hidden moisture in residential construction is common — particularly in older homes where plumbing has been repaired multiple times, waterproofing has failed, or chronic condensation has occurred in wall cavities.

Potential consequences: Hidden moisture creates conditions for mold growth, wood deterioration, and structural damage that may not be visible during a standard home inspection. Moisture meters and targeted investigation are required to assess the full extent.

When reconstruction may be necessary: Hidden moisture findings require investigation to determine the source and extent before a reconstruction scope can be defined. In some cases, targeted exploratory work is necessary to assess conditions behind finished surfaces.

Structural Deterioration

Common causes: Structural deterioration from water damage occurs when moisture exposure is chronic and long-term — affecting sill plates, rim joists, floor joists, wall framing, and other load-bearing components.

Potential consequences: Structural deterioration affects the safety, insurability, and lendability of the property. Lenders and insurers may require documentation of structural repairs before completing a transaction.

When reconstruction may be necessary: Structural reconstruction requires assessment by a licensed contractor, replacement of affected members, and documentation of the completed work — including permits where required by California building code.

Tile Failures

Common causes: Tile failures — cracked, loose, or missing tile — in wet areas indicate substrate movement, waterproofing failure, or improper installation that allows moisture infiltration into the assembly below.

Potential consequences: Tile failures in showers and tub surrounds allow water to bypass the tile surface and saturate the substrate. What appears to be a minor cosmetic issue often indicates a more significant waterproofing failure.

When reconstruction may be necessary: Tile failure reconstruction scope depends on the condition of the substrate. Surface tile replacement is appropriate only when the substrate and waterproofing are intact. Failed substrates require full reconstruction.

Window Leaks

Common causes: Window leaks result from failed sealants, deteriorated flashing, improper installation, or window frame deterioration — allowing water to enter the wall assembly around the window opening.

Potential consequences: Window leaks saturate wall framing, insulation, and interior finishes. In stucco-clad homes, window leaks are a common source of significant hidden moisture damage that is difficult to detect without investigation.

When reconstruction may be necessary: Window leak reconstruction requires addressing the source — resealing, reflashing, or replacing the window — and repairing the damaged wall assembly, which may include framing, sheathing, insulation, and interior finishes.

Roof Leaks Affecting Interior Finishes

Common causes: Roof leaks that reach interior finishes indicate that water has penetrated the roof assembly and migrated through attic framing, insulation, and ceiling materials — often traveling significant distances from the entry point.

Potential consequences: Roof leak damage to interior finishes indicates that the attic framing, insulation, and ceiling structure may have sustained moisture damage. The visible staining on ceilings and walls is often the last indication of a larger problem.

When reconstruction may be necessary: Interior reconstruction from roof leaks requires addressing the roof penetration, assessing attic framing and insulation condition, and restoring affected ceilings and walls — with documentation of all work performed.

Water damage reconstruction requires more than removing damaged materials and installing new ones. It requires understanding how buildings work, how moisture moves through building assemblies, and how to build systems that prevent recurrence. The Paragon Standard defines how we approach every water damage reconstruction project.

Diagnosis Before Demolition

We evaluate conditions thoroughly before recommending demolition. Understanding the source, extent, and construction implications of water damage allows us to define the minimum scope necessary to properly address the problem — rather than defaulting to maximum demolition.

Building Science

We understand how moisture moves through building assemblies — through capillary action, vapor diffusion, and bulk water transport. This knowledge allows us to identify the actual source of moisture damage and design reconstruction that addresses the root cause.

Water Management

Proper water management — directing water away from building assemblies through slope, drainage, and waterproofing — is the foundation of durable construction. We design reconstruction to manage water appropriately rather than simply replacing damaged materials.

Proper Waterproofing

Waterproofing systems in wet areas must be appropriate for the application, properly installed, and integrated with adjacent building systems. We install waterproofing systems that meet current California building standards and are appropriate for the specific conditions of each project.

Making Informed Decisions

When Reconstruction Is Recommended

Not every water damage finding requires extensive reconstruction. Minor surface damage — staining, paint discoloration, small areas of drywall damage — may be addressed through targeted repairs without full reconstruction. The appropriate scope depends on the actual conditions, not on the presence of water damage alone.

Reconstruction is typically recommended when structural materials, waterproofing systems, or concealed building components have been compromised by moisture. The key question is not whether there is water damage, but whether the damage has affected the building systems that protect the structure from future moisture intrusion.

A professional evaluation provides the objective assessment needed to answer that question. We assess conditions without a predetermined conclusion — recommending the scope of work that is actually necessary, whether that is a targeted repair or full reconstruction.

Reconstruction is typically appropriate when:

Waterproofing systems have failed and moisture has reached structural materials

Subfloor or framing members show signs of deterioration, wood rot, or structural compromise

Mold is present in wall or floor assemblies behind finished surfaces

The moisture source cannot be corrected without opening walls or floors

Surface repairs would leave compromised building systems in place

Lender or insurance requirements specify reconstruction with documentation

The extent of damage cannot be fully assessed without exploratory demolition

When reconstruction is not necessary, we say so. Our goal is to provide accurate information — not to maximize the scope of work.
